Amazing Huchuy Qosqo

On our final full day in Urubamba "we bused to Lamay and walked up to Huchuy Qosqo, something we had originally ruled out during planning due to 800m ascend at altitude. I barely survived." Says Sun-Ling.

Huchuy Qosqo is an Ican Archaeological Site up on the west side of the Sacred Valley above Calca and Lamay. And "by foot" is just about the only way to get to Huchuy Qosqo; horse back and possibly motorcycle are the others. There are more than several walking routes to reach to Huchuy Qosqo, all tough. We chose to walk up from Lamay. It's an 800 meter elevation gain pretty much straight up as you'll see in the photos.

Not included on the Boleto Turisitco, Huchuy Qosqo admission is 7 soles. Once up top at the site, the views are tremendous across the Sacred Valley and the terraces can be described as more than mesmerizing or the gift that keeps on giving.
